    Pac-man (National Lottery scratchcard)

    Awesome!

    Not seen any mention of this anywhere previously, so I was a bit surprised to spot it whilst picking up some smokes at the local Co-op....


    Anyway, first impressions are good...



    Gameplay remains true to the classic, with players having to scratch off a line of 5 dots to reveal either a Pac-man or a Ghost icon under each dot.

    Get 5 pac-men in a row and you win the prize at the end of the line! One ghost and it's all over though.


    The game itself is fantastically easy to pick up, but a proper bitch to master. Each card gives you 5 goes, and so far I've made it unscathed to the very last dot on a number of occasions - only to be royally shafted by a ghost at the very end.

    It's not all over then though - if 3 of the 5 possible prizes available on each card all match... then you still win that prize! I've netted 3 quid so far using this method, and I reckon it could prove to be a useful technique.



    Overall presentation is good, with a nice rendered Paccers at the top of the card and some old-skool style ghosts also putting in an appearance. In-game graphics are a bit of a let down however - the simple monochrome icons are easy to make out but could have benefitted from a little more work really.



    Despite the obvious problems with the difficulty and presentation, I'm happy to say it's definitely got that elusive one-more-go appeal and as such comes highly recommended.


    Nice one Namco!
